PAR 1005 - INT EMT - Basic Field Exp I

Institution:
Weber State University
Subject:
Paramedics
Description:
Minimum 120 hours of supervised EMT-Basic patient care experience provided through assigned day shifts on the ambulance and/or pre-hospital setting. A preceptor evaluates basic life support knowledge, skills and affective abilities.
